John Sullivan
District 5190 Governor 2016-2017
R.I. President, John Germ
International Theme: “Rotary Serving Humanity”
 
While John was born in Maine, he grew up in the suburbs of Los Angeles. John attended California State Polytechnic University, Pomona and received a degree in Social Science with an option in Economics.  After college, John served in the United States Army and attended the Defense Information School.  John was assigned to Army Headquarters in Vietnam. There John was the Assistant Editor and a Combat Correspondent for The Army Reporter, a weekly newspaper.  As part of this assignment, John worked at the Stars and Stripes printing plant in Tokyo supervising the production of his newspaper.  During his military service, John met Sandy, whom he married in 1970.
 
After completing his military service, John was employed for nineteen years by a Fortune 100 company in a variety of management positions. During this time period, John returned to California State Polytechnic University, Pomona and received his Masters of Business Administration degree.  Thereafter John attended Southwestern University of Law where he earned his Juris Doctorate, cum laude.  During his last seven years with the Fortune 100 Company, John was an Associate Counsel and served as chair of a company-wide contracts committee.
 
For five years, John was employed by two medium size law firms and focused his efforts on civil litigation. Thereafter, John formed his own firm and emphasized civil litigation and contract preparation and review.  John retired from the active practice of  law in 2010. Sandy, who had for many years worked in the retirement compliance area of several financial institutions retired at the same time.
 
John joined his first Rotary Club, the Rotary Club of Placentia, in 2001 after being impressed by their wide-range of projects he learned about at a "Reverse Raffle" dinner. During his four plus years with the Placentia Club, John served as Club Secretary and participated in a home building project in Mexico.
 
When John and Sandy were getting ready to move to Pine Grove, CA he attended a make-up meeting at the Rotary Club of Jackson. Then DG Dave Bianchi was making his Club visit that night and discussed club activities. Impressed with these activities, John joined the Rotary Club of Jackson in 2005. John served as Club Secretary and during 2011-2012 was the Club President.
At the District level, John served as District Secretary for five years from 2009 to 2014 and has been a member of the District's training team. As part of the training team, he has been a trainer at District Assemblies, Rotary Leadership Institutes, and Grants Management Seminars. John also chaired the Technology Committee in 2013-2014 and chaired of the Grants Sub-committee  in 2014-2015.
John and Sandy are both Paul Harris Fellows, Major Donors, and members of the Bequest Society and he is a member of the Paul Harris Society.
